SOLOMON v. PARKSIDE MEDICAL SERV. CORP.

No. 01-93-00218-CV.

882 S.W.2d 492 (1994)

Barry SOLOMON, Appellant, v. PARKSIDE MEDICAL SERVICES CORP., Appellee.

Court of Appeals of Texas, Houston (1st Dist.).

Rehearing Denied September 15, 1994.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Bennett G. Fisher, Houston, for appellant.

Molly Steele and Jane Politz Brandt, Dallas, for appellee.

Before MIRABAL, WILSON and HEDGES, JJ.


OPINION

MIRABAL, Justice.

The trial court overruled appellant Barry Solomon's motion to reinstate this case on the docket after the case had been dismissed for want of prosecution. In a single point of error, appellant complains that the trial court erred in overruling his motion to reinstate without an oral hearing. We affirm.
